Cap fragment, earflap
Stocking stitch knitted ear flap. Cut edge sewn to hat; increasing stitches from cut edge; stitch holes present at narrow end; cast on and cast off edges sewn together at widest edge; stitch holes at bottom of ear flap. Yarn diameter: 1.9 mm, 2 ply, Z spun.
The piece was bought by the London Museum in 1924 and no further find details are known.
